Effortlessly Revive Potted Plants with WD-40 and Kitchen Staples

Calcium buildup on the outside of potted plants can be removed using WD-40. First, clean the planter of dirt and debris. Shake the can of WD-40 and spray a light coat onto the affected areas. Let it sit for a few minutes, then scrub with a soft cloth or brush. Rinse with water to remove residue. To prevent future buildup, use filtered or rainwater for watering and regularly clean the planters.

Revive Your Old Scissors with This Simple Hack

Instead of throwing out your old pair of scissors when they become dull or rusty, you can use WD-40 to keep them sharp and rust-free. WD-40, known for its versatility around the house, was actually invented to prevent and remove rust. Simply spray WD-40 onto the scissors, focusing on the fulcrum, and scrub off any oxidized metal. For extremely rusted scissors, you can enhance the effectiveness of WD-40 by using a salt-and-bag trick and rubbing a lemon over the blades. Rust-free scissors not only ensure clean cuts but also prevent safety concerns.

Stocks React to Fed Commentary and Bond Yields, Making Moves After Hours

WD-40 stock rose 4% in after-hours trading after reporting strong fiscal third-quarter results, with net sales up 15% and net income up 30% year over year. The company's CEO expressed confidence in its ability to perform well in the long run. On the other hand, PriceSmart stock fell 5% in after-hours trading despite announcing a stock buyback program and reporting solid financial results, including a 6.4% increase in total revenue and a 65% increase in adjusted net income. Investors were looking for stronger evidence of a recovery from the warehouse retailer.

Garage Door Maintenance: Tips and Tricks for a Quieter Door.

WD-40 is not recommended for lubricating garage doors as it is not a lubricant and can damage the powder-coat finish and nylon rollers. Garage doors need occasional lubrication to keep them opening and closing smoothly, and there are many products available that work much better than WD-40, such as 3-in-1 Professional Garage Door Lubricant and Blaster Silicone Garage Door Lubricant.
